Find the best attractions in and around Llangranog

Llangranog offers a delightful blend of outdoor activities and stunning scenery, perfect for a beach vacation. Visitors can enjoy the charming coastal village, explore the beautiful Cilborth beaches, and take in the breathtaking views of craggy cliffs. Popular attractions include the nearby castles and picturesque waterfalls, making it an ideal destination for those seeking a mix of culture and adventure by the sea.

  • Llangrannog Beach: This picturesque beach offers a tranquil escape with its soft sands and gentle waves, making it ideal for relaxation and beachcombing. The vibrant coastal atmosphere is perfect for enjoying sun-filled days and catching stunning sunsets.
  • Cilgerran Castle: Nestled 13km away, this historical castle boasts impressive architecture and rich cultural heritage. The romantic setting, surrounded by lush landscapes, invites exploration of its ancient walls and stunning views of the Teifi River.
  • Cenarth Falls: Located 14km away, Cenarth Falls is a captivating natural wonder that offers outdoor adventures. The cascading waters create a serene ambiance, perfect for a romantic stroll or a thrilling kayaking experience amidst breathtaking scenery.

Best time to go to Llangranog

The best time to visit Llangranog is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July and August are its hottest month on average. At the time of August,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y. January and February are its coolest month on average. At the time of February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January43.0°F (6.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February43.0°F (6.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March44.4°F (6.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April47.5°F (8.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
June57.0°F (13.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
July59.7°F (15.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August59.7°F (15.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
October53.6°F (12.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November48.6°F (9.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What's the seasonal weather like in Llangranog?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Llangranog is 1203 mm.
